Fomena Polling Station: Aggrevied Members Caution NPP Executives To Act Fast Or They Will Defer To NDC

Aggrieved polling agent executives at the Fomena Constituency in the Adansi Region are unhappy with how the elections were conducted emphasising that, if they party executives don't act up soon they will all defer to NDC.

Fox morning drive hist, Sir John in an interview with one of the aggrieved executives, Benjamin Ofoi, stated that it all started last week Friday in the hours of 2:00-3:00 pm when former MP for Bantama constituency, Chairman Kokofu brought in the forms.

Explaining, he noted that, they got to know the forms wasn't signed nor stamped and even the date on it had expired so they approached Kokofu and indicated it to him, but he told them is not necessary and means nothing telling them they should go ahead and fill it because they will come for them on Saturday as vetting will commence on Sunday and Monday but didn't hear from him again till they heard on Monday that they were vetting.

Ofori disclosed how angered they were but at that time they had gone for a court injunction to be placed on it and proceeded to the DCE, Hon Eric Kwasi Kusi to hand it over to him since he is part of the election committee but they got kicked out by his securities.

He added that the executives should know that when one is joining the NPP party they don't submit an application or resignation so they should be cautious of their actions to put the party on top come the 2024 elections because they can't force Hon Asamiah on them.

If they don't act up, they will all resign and join the National Democratic Congress
